Exercise 1: Complete using the correct present perfect simple form of the verbs in brackets.
1. I have seen this film already. (see)
2. John and Julie have had their car for about a year. (have)
3. She has not taken her driving test yet. (not / take)
4. Sue has been a tour guide since she left university. (be)
5. Haven't you ridden into town on your new bike yet? (you / ride)
6. This new computer has made my life a lot easier. (make)
7. We haven't decided what to get Mark for his birthday yet. (not / decide)
8. Has Paul ever met a famous person?

Exercise 3: Look at the picture and use the prompts to write sentences. Use the correct form of the present perfect simple.
1. lesson / not / start / yet
Lesson has not started yet.

2. teacher / already / write / on the board
The teacher has already written on the board.

3. Joe and Tim / just / come / into the classroom
Joe and Tim have just come into the classroom.

4. Tony / not / finished / getting / books ready
Tony has not finished getting books ready.

5. Christine / already / open / book
Christine has already opened the book.

6. Dave / drop / pen / on the floor
Dave has dropped his pen on the floor.

7. he / not / pick it up / yet
He has not picked it up yet.
